Transaction 077828dafdcc0bed32145979f3ce5500f5994c9f2a232e9cec5392d1ada77857
1 Input
1 Output
-
077828dafdcc0bed32145979f3ce5500f5994c9f2a232e9cec5392d1ada77857:0
- value
- 29975392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b28ccf0a67c13dd55e1e33fde3dab9ef98bb8921 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HH5xi9ce1EqAgsJrmB7FrXRhMkV2sKyth